Job Overview: Process Specialist – Workforce Management (WFM)
Location: Fully Onsite (Alabang, Muntinlupa) | Schedule: Shifting
Core Responsibilities
- Strategic Staffing: Develop forecasting and staffing models to ensure optimal headcount and operational efficiency.
- Resource Management: Provide planning oversight for specific business units, balancing volume against available resources.
- Stakeholder Collaboration: Partner with business leaders to anticipate upcoming projects or model changes that might impact staffing needs.
- Data Analysis: Generate volume projections for contact centers and back-office departments.
- Metric Monitoring: Regularly evaluate key drivers—including volume, AHT (Average Handle Time), shrinkage, and occupancy—against the original plan to recommend data-driven adjustments.
Candidate Requirements
- Education: College degree in any field.
- Experience: At least 3 years of WFM experience, ideally within a BPO or shared services environment.
- Core Competencies: Proven background in forecasting, scheduling, capacity planning, and reporting.
- Technical Proficiency: High level of expertise in MS Excel; familiarity with WFM tools (e.g., Verint, Genesys, IEX, or Aspect) is a significant advantage.
